A nice game. A few game points, and other interesting items:
  • Butler fielded only one ball with her bad hand, and pulled it back several times instead of catching the ball. Mentally she does not appear to be there, yet; with an injury like hers, that is to be expected. No worries with the rest of her game.
  • No Bon-Bon, but she looked fine in warmups. Got beaned with a loose ball; she's just not used to warming the bench.
  • GREAT game by "Tommy" Chong! Next year is looking brighter every day.
  • Geno applauded the effort of Courtney Ekmark a couple of times. He doesn't do that often.
  • Nurse had an off game, but it didn't stop her. Good sign for a shooter.
  • Tuck was...Tuck. The Silent Assassin strikes again!
  • The crowd is FINALLY getting the hang of "Lllllooooooooouuuu" for KLS. We should be ready come AAC tournament time.
  • Who enjoys running the three-pointer high-five line more, Pulido or Stewart?
  • Ted "Big Cat" Plawecki was in the house! No Hat, but he says he will wear it to some more games, this year.
  • Anyone seen Carol, the Jonathan Puppet lady? I haven't seen her at very many games, this year.
